NORD to unveil new trade show booth and drive products at IPPE

ByMCTips Staff|January 15, 2019

Share

NORD Gear Corporation is attending the world’s largest annual poultry, meat and feed industry event, theInternational Production & Processing Expo (IPPE). There, NORD will be discussing cost-saving aluminum alloy drive systems for the food processing industry.

, 2月12日至14日在举行tlanta’s Georgia World Congress Center, attracts more than 30,000 visitors. Drive system experts from NORD will present high-efficiency overhead conveyor, screw conveyor, bevel and in-line gearmotor solutions at booth #8013. Highlights include:

  • NORD’s modular Screw Conveyor Package is ideal for food processors. This high-efficiency design eliminates the need for costly separate V-belt drives by providing integral gearmotors or direct-coupled motors to a NEMA C-face reducer. Minimizing parts and eliminating the need for top motor mounts, pulleys, belts or guards provides easier system maintenance, increased reliability, and superior drive performance.
  • 北方的替代不锈钢齿轮减速器s, motors and VFDs is a high-strength NSD TUPH aluminum alloy surface conversion. Ideal for poultry and meat processing companies, this breakthrough material has the superior washdown advantages of stainless steel – with 30 percent less cost. Plus, aluminum is lighter than stainless steel, and has superior heat transfer properties. Sample NSD TUPH materials are available at the NORD booth for testing.
  • Designed for the food and beverage industry applications, NORD’s overhead conveyor drives offer heavy-duty construction and high-quality machined components. With high efficiency and minimal maintenance requirements, the SK9055 and SK9155 have a low overall cost of ownership while providing reliable operation in food processing plants around the world. These overhead conveyor drives are designed with a mounting flange and output shaft that easily drop into industry-standard footprints. The gear units incorporate the standard NORD VL3 spread bearing design with a dry cavity.
